BRUNSWICK — Katherine N. Lamkin, 87, of Harpswell, died Oct. 29, at Parkview Hospital, surrounded by her loving family.

Kay was born Feb. 27, 1925, in China and graduated from Cony High School in 1941. Since 1985, she and her husband of 63 years had enjoyed winters in Florida, and summers in New Hampshire, and Maine. Together, they visited every U.S. state and most of the Canadian provinces.

Kay also enjoyed playing shuffleboard and competed at a “Pro” level and she also taught shuffleboard seven years. Her other hobbies included reading, crocheting, knitting, cross stitch and dancing. Kay’s greatest joy was the time spent with her family.

She is survived by her children, Jean French and her husband, Don, of Lincolnville, Sueanne Quirion and her husband, Frank, of Augusta, Truman Lamkin and his wife, Sandy, of Haverhill, Mass., and Mark Lamkin and his wife, Linda, of Manchester, N.H.; her sisters, Muriel Plummer, Beverly Hinkley and Barbara Wakely and her husband, Tim; 14 grandchildren; 33 great-grandchildren; six great-great-grandchildren; and numerous nieces and nephews.

She was predeceased by her parents, Walter and Laura Given Clark; her brothers, James, Walter and Arthur Clark; and her sisters, Marjorie Hewitt and Loretta Boatner.
